GREENVILLE

Rev. Sering to receive honorary doctorate

The Rev. Richard Sering, founding director and current executive director of Lutheran Metropolitan Ministry in Cleveland, will receive an honorary doctor of social justice degree from Thiel College at an 11:30 a.m. ceremony on Friday at the college's William A. Passavant Memorial Center.

Nominated for the doctorate by colleague Rev. Kermit R. Lauterbach, retired pastor of the All Saints Lutheran Church in Olmsted Falls, Ohio, Sering is widely known for his work toward social justice.

As LMM executive director since 1969, Sering developed numerous ministries such as the ecumenical Community Re-Entry Program, an ex-offenders program created in 1971. The program has received many accolades over the years, most notably from people such as former U.S. Attorney General Janet Reno and President Clinton, who, at the 1994 National Safety Forum, cited it as a top example of positive community response to urban crime at the 1994 National Safety Forum.

Sering is also noted for developing other caring community ministries such as the Long Term Care Ombudsman Program, the Citizens of Cuyahoga County Ombudsman Program, the Volunteer Guardianship Program, Support To At-Risk Teens, the Westhaven Youth Shelter, the Youth Re-Entry Program, Services to Adult Care Homes, Linking Employment Ability & Potential, Maximum Independent Living, and the Lutheran Housing Corporation of Cleveland.

A member of numerous organizations and the recipient of several awards and honors, Sering has been active with the Northeastern Ohio Synod of the Evangelical Lutheran Church in America. A Lutheran pastor -- Sering earned his master of divinity degree from Concordia Seminary in 1965 -- Sering led the St. Michael Lutheran Church outside St. Louis for four years before coming to Cleveland.

Sering's honorary will be awarded during the Northeastern Ohio Synod's assembly at Thiel, which runs Friday and Saturday.
